You have to buy it in person, with your passport, at the shop and fill in a claim form (which you hand in at the UK airport on your return) to get a refund for the taxes. I usually save my pennies all year then treat myself to a nice bag on my return to UK in summer. I have tried to do it online but no-one has let me yet..maybe this is because of the £250 max thing or because they need to see your overseas visa? For the 1st trimester Dr. put me on folic acid (which i had been taking for 6 months before i conceived anyway) and Duphaston (still don't know what they were for honestly and i stopped taking them after a couple of weeks. 2nd trimester Dr. put me on Promise vitamins in morning, ferose chewable iron in afternoon and caltrate (calcium) in the evening. 3rd trimester (new doctor) now i'm on Pregnacare, feroglobin and caltrate. Hi Mrs Abdala The duphaston is extra progesterone which some drs believe prevent miscarriage..my dr put me on it and told me that it is not proven to prevent but even if it doesn't work it doesn't harm so why not take them until 12 weeks (I had a miscarriage before my two kids were born) so I just did as I was told :) From 12 weeks dr took me off the folic acid and duphaston and put me on Elevit in the morning and Calcivit in the evening. Been on these since and Dr happy with everything so far.
